
The Sri Lankan cricket authorities cleared seven of its eight players to play in the BCCI backed multi-million Indian Premier League IPL scheduled for April next year.
Captain Mahela Jayawardene and spin wizard Muttiah Muralitharan are among the top players to have signed up to play in theinaugural season of the IPL.
8220;We have approved the names of seven players to play for IPL and the eighth player Nuwan Zoysa does not have a contract with us though his name will also be cleared for playing in the league,8221; Secretary of Sri Lankan Cricket SLC K Mathivanan said.
The IPL will be played in the Twenty20 format and is being seen as an answer to the rebel Indian Cricket League ICL floated by the Essel Group.
